Will isync sync two macs?

can you use isync to sync entourage data between an imac and macbook?
what about documents and such?
thanks,
tom

No, iSync is for syncing Contacts and Calendars to supported mobile phones and PDAs.
*.Mac Sync* is for syncing between Macs, but only certain data types - not documents, files etc.
ChronoSync will allow you sync documents and files between Macs.

    Is it possible to use iSync to sync two macs?
    I use a PowerBook and a Mac Mini and it would be handy if address contacts and calendars could by synced easily.
    I would rather not get a .mac account.
    Surely another mac should show up when you click 'add device' in iSync?

    In addition to the information Julian provided, you can use commercial software as an alternative to .Mac for some synchronization purposes.
    SyncTogether from Mark/Space will synchronize five of the six .Mac data categories across user accounts on a single machine, across users on a local area network, and across the internet. Keychain synchronization is not supported.
    BusySync from BusyMac provides local area network only synchronization and sharing of otherwise read-only iCal calendars.
    You can also investigate such products as SpanningSync for synchronization of iCal calendars using Google, and Plaxo, which offers contact, event and tasks synchronization—in a not quite ready for prime time beta release—for the Address Book and iCal.

    I have an intel imac and thinking of buying a macbook, is it possible to sync the two automatically so both machines are almost identical?
    Chris

    I use ChronoSync, and it works very well. You would run it on one of your Macs. As long as the other Mac is accessible on the local network (wired or wireless), it will keep two folders in sync. The sync works both ways, so if you update a file on the iMac, that update gets synced to the MacBook. If you update a file on the MacBook, that update gets synced to the iMac. If you happen to update the same file on both Macs between a sync, ChronoSync asks which one you want to keep. The sync can take place manually, or on a defined schedule.
    You can even use it between a Mac and an Windows PC.

    I just got a second Mac. I would like to sync my PowerBook (files, mail, calendar, and all) with my second Mac everyday. How do I go about doing that? What software do I use? Appreciate your help.
    Thank you so much.
    Jimmy

    Jimmy:
    I am not sure exactly what you mean by synching. If you mean you want the second Mac to be exactly like the first Mac you can use Firewire Target Disk Mode and then use SuperDuper or Carbon Copy Cloner. To make regular updates (SmartUpdates) with SuperDuper you will need to register your SuperDuper for $8.95. Then you don't need to do a full clone each time. A full clone can take a couple of hours; a SmartUpdate, if done daily, will take about 20 minutes.

    I have a 2012 Mini running Server, and a 2012 MBP. The Mini is my main machine, and I use the MBP when I'm outside the house or just sitting on the sofa.
    Anyway, I want the MBP to be a mirror of my Mini's user account. Mail is sorted by IMAP servers; I use iCloud for contacts, calendars, photos and iTunes.
    But that still leaves the documents. Ideally, I want REAL TIME syncing, like you get with DropBox. But just between the two machines when they are on the same LAN.
    Someone has suggested using mobile user accounts, but I'm not sure that's ideal. Am I right that it only syncs when logging out? In any case, the two user accounts are likely to be logged in simultaneously, which is asking for trouble.
    I'm surprised this isn't asked more often -- if it has been and my Google fu is lacking, please point me in the right direction. I've looked at other products but most don't offer real time.
    Thanks

    FWIW, I've not yet encountered a really good generic real-time documentation synchronization tool — they all have trade-offs.
    Having users logged in and active in parallel and the resulting necessity to resolve conflicts is not an easy problem, in the defense of the folks working on this.
    The Apple solution here is iCloud for the documents that supports.   I've previously tried using Apple's portable home directories mechanism (PHDs), and those do work but have their own requirements and some limitations — and the requirement to deal with the occasional synch bugs and synch conflicts.  
    Tools such as rsync and git can be common recommendations with trade-offs, and using those terms and searches for alternatives to DropBox will find you various other discussions. 
    OwnCloud will be another approach, but with a different approach and with different requirements and limitations.
